Additionally, do you put pesto on pasta before or after cooking? The Most Important Rule of Cooking With Pesto: Don’t Cook It

  1. Step 1: Boil pasta until al dente.
  2. Step 2: Transfer pasta to a mixing or serving bowl.
  3. Step 3: Add pesto.
  4. Step 4: Add pasta water bit by bit, mixing to bind and emulsify the oil-based sauce.
  5. Step 5: Eat.

Is all pesto vegan?

Is pesto vegan friendly? The classic pesto recipe is, unfortunately, not vegan because it’s made with fresh basil, garlic, pine nuts, oil, and parmesan cheese. Thankfully, it doesn’t take much to make a delicious vegan pesto. Just remove the dairy and mix and match a few other ingredients.

Is pesto a veggie?

Is Pesto vegan? Most Pesto is made with cheese which contains animal rennet so it is not suitable for vegans or vegetarians. If you’re making your own pesto, simply swap the cheese for one that is suitable for vegans and add some nutritional yeast for extra flavour. Try our Gnocchi with Vegan Pesto recipe.

What is green pesto made of?

It traditionally consists of crushed garlic, European pine nuts, coarse salt, basil leaves, and hard cheese such as Parmigiano-Reggiano (also known as Parmesan cheese) or Pecorino Sardo (cheese made from sheep’s milk), all blended with olive oil.
